Handling and Storage
First off, when it comes to handling semi - silica bricks, you've got to be careful. These bricks are heavy, and improper handling can lead to some serious injuries. Always use the right lifting equipment, like forklifts or pallet jacks, when moving large quantities of bricks. If you're moving them by hand, make sure you lift with your legs, not your back. This simple technique can save you from a lot of back pain and potential long - term injuries.
When it comes to storage, keep the bricks in a dry place. Moisture can weaken the bricks and affect their performance. A covered warehouse or storage shed is ideal. Stack the bricks neatly and securely to prevent them from toppling over. You don't want a pile of heavy bricks crashing down on someone!
Installation
During the installation process, safety is of the utmost importance. Wear the right personal protective equipment (PPE). This includes safety goggles to protect your eyes from flying debris, gloves to protect your hands from cuts and abrasions, and a dust mask to prevent you from inhaling any fine particles.
Make sure the installation area is well - ventilated. Cutting or grinding semi - silica bricks can generate dust, which can be harmful if inhaled. If you're working in an enclosed space, use a ventilation system or exhaust fans to keep the air fresh.

When laying the bricks, ensure that the surface is level and stable. Uneven surfaces can cause the bricks to shift or crack, which can compromise the integrity of the structure. Use the right mortar and follow the manufacturer's instructions for mixing and application. A poorly mixed mortar can lead to weak joints and a less durable installation.
Operation
Once the semi - silica bricks are installed and the equipment is up and running, there are still safety precautions to consider. Monitor the temperature of the equipment regularly. Semi - silica bricks have a specific temperature range in which they perform optimally. Exceeding this range can cause the bricks to expand, crack, or even melt, which can be extremely dangerous.
Keep an eye out for any signs of wear and tear. Check for cracks, chips, or other damage to the bricks. If you notice any issues, address them immediately. A small crack can quickly turn into a major problem if left untreated.
Maintenance
Regular maintenance is key to ensuring the continued safe operation of the equipment. Inspect the semi - silica bricks periodically for any signs of damage or deterioration. Clean the bricks regularly to remove any dirt, debris, or chemical deposits. This can help prevent corrosion and extend the lifespan of the bricks.
If you need to replace any bricks, do it as soon as possible. Using damaged bricks can lead to safety hazards and reduce the efficiency of the equipment. When replacing the bricks, follow the same safety precautions as during the installation process.
